This dataset provides spatial predictions of habitat suitability for Gopherus agassizii (Agassiz’s desert tortoise), Gopherus morafkai (Morafka’s desert tortoise) and a pooled-species model under current conditions (1950 – 2000 yr). The raster layers contained here accompany the manuscript Inman et al. 2019 and were used to evaluate subtle ecological niche differences between G. agassizii and G. morafkai, and identify local species-environment relationships. Spatial predictions of habitat suitability were created using MaxEnt version 3.4.0 (Phillips et al., 2006), a widely-used software for SDM in presence-background frameworks. The urbanized area of downtown Menlo Park is subject to persistent flooding and sediment deposition by San Francisquito Creek in South San Francisco Bay. To mitigate these events, a suite of cores was collected in 2002 at the mouth of the creek to determine sediment depositional rates on the delta. One of those cores (721-1) was selected for microbiological (pollen, diatoms, and foraminifera) and geochemical analyses to reconstruct a depositional record over the past two millennia. This data release provides radiocarbon dates, census counts of benthic foraminifera, diatoms, and palynomorphs, and the measurement of anthropogenic metals and other elements in sediments from this core.

This dataset contains the physical collection information (e.g., sample location, date, gear type) and microsatellite DNA genotype of egg and larval Lake Sturgeon collected in the St. Clair and Detroit rivers in 2015 and 2016. Individuals were genotyped for 18 microsatellite loci (13 disomic and 5 polysomic). Alleles (base pair sizes) were recorded as presence absence scores (1:present, 2:absent, 0:missing data) for all previously observed alleles. Thus individual genotypes were recorded as pseudo diploid dominant phenotypes resulting in individual vectors of length n=205 for each genotyped egg or larval individual.

This refined map was created to help assess possible spread of nonindigenous aquatic species distributions due to flooding associated with Hurricane Harvey. Storm surge and flood events can assist expansion and dissemination of nonindigenous aquatic species through the connection of adjacent watersheds, backflow of water upstream of impoundments, increased downstream flow, and creation of freshwater bridges along coastal regions. This map will help natural resource managers determine potential new locations for individual species, or to develop a watch list of possible new species within a watershed.
